摘要
This study is based on the hypothesis that television contents themselves constitute a source of learning through television narratives. In specific terms, we defend the idea that it is possible to teach and learn values through said narratives. Some of the research dealing with the relationship between television and values is categorized from a three-fold standpoint: the contents themselves, the medium itself and the language. As a result of this review, we maintain that reiterated attacks on television, blaming it for the majority of problems suffered by young people today, are not supported by the studies carried out by psychologists over recent decades. We believe that viewers incorporate the information provided by television from different contexts and that the enculturation is not unidirectional. There is an interrelation between development contexts and messages. We are specifically interested in analyzing the implicit and explicit values underlying television contents. Thus, based on the model developed by Schwartz and Bilsky, we have compiled a questionnaire (Val-TV 0.1) with the aim of classifying values and interpreting the behaviours visualized in television texts, and relating them to adolescents' own values. © Springer Science+Business Media, Inc. 2007.
